South Africans took to social media to share photos of the supermoon.

According to NASA, a supermoon is an optical illusion caused by the moon being so close to the horizon that it can be measured against familiar objects such as trees and houses.
This year sees the most spectacular supermoon since 1948 with the moon appearing 30 percent brighter than usual.
"The event was undeniably beautiful," space agency NASA said on its website.
ALSO READ: SA to experience rare supermoon
Nasa says this is the closest the moon has been to earth in 69 years.
